The State Street Investor Confidence Index reading of the outlook of institutional investors showed a four-point decline in September to 88, down from 92 in August. In North America, the drop was more pronounced; the confidence level fell 7.3 points to 87.9 from August’s reading of 95.2.

Vanguard Group plans to simplify its Target Retirement Funds and certain other funds-of-funds in an effort to improve the products’ international diversification.The Valley Forge, Pa., company plans to replace the funds' three underlying international portfolios with a single broad international stock index fund. Vanguard will also increase the overall international equity exposure of these funds.

Fidelity Investments has added a Bank Deposit Portfolio to its five direct-sold 529 college savings plans: New Hampshire’s UNIQUE College Investing Plan, California’s ScholarShare College Savings Plan, Massachusetts’ U.Fund College Investing Plan, the Delaware College Investment Plan and the Fidelity Arizona College Savings Plan.

A number of Build America Bond issuers are seeking voluntary closing agreements with the Internal Revenue Service to settle accidental violations of a de minimis premium rule, an IRS official told industry officials in Manhattan yesterday.
